Particle Health Secures $12M in Series A Funding

Particle Health, a NYC-based digital healthcare company, raised $12m in Series A funding.

The round was led by Menlo Ventures, with participation from existing investors Collaborative Fund, Story Ventures and Company Ventures and executives from Flatiron Health, Clover Health, Plaid, Petal and Hometeam. Greg Yap, Partner at Menlo Ventures, joined the Particle Health board of directors.

The company intends to use the funds to continue to expand operations and its business reach.

Founded in December 2017 by CEO Troy Bannister and CTO Dan Horbatt, Particle Health provides secure access to vital patient health data by leveraging a HIPAA compliant API. Over 1.4M record transactions have already been completed using its API by top tier telemedicine, pharmacy and virtual health companies.
